Residential construction costs have been a topic of considerable curiosity and concern for many potential owners and real estate traders. These costs significantly have an result on housing affordability and influence total market dynamics. Understanding the assorted parts that contribute to those bills is essential for anyone looking to navigate the complexities of homebuilding or renovation.
The prices related to residential construction can vary widely based mostly on several components, together with location, materials, labor, and design complexity. In city areas where land is more expensive, one can expect construction costs to rise correspondingly. Moreover, local building laws and codes also can contribute to variations in prices, as they dictate the standards that must be adhered to during construction.
Labor costs play an important position in residential construction expenditures. Skilled labor is often in short supply, driving up wages for contractors and tradespeople. The demand for construction workers tends to fluctuate, driven by financial cycles and seasonal climate patterns. Thus, understanding the local labor market is important when estimating overall construction costs.

Materials are perhaps probably the most visible factor influencing construction costs (Variety of services from local experts Northridge, CA). The worth of uncooked materials such as lumber, concrete, and metal can range based on market demand, availability, and transportation costs. Recently, disruptions in global provide chains have caused significant swings in material prices, making it challenging for builders to provide correct estimates
Environmental factors are additionally necessary to suppose about. For occasion, regions susceptible to natural disasters may necessitate additional engineering and materials to make sure properties are resilient. This consideration can add to both upfront costs and long-term maintenance bills. Builders should assess geographical dangers when planning tasks, as this will have an enduring impact on residential construction prices.

Home design and complexity play a significant role in figuring out whole construction prices. Simple designs that comply with typical layouts are usually more cost-effective than intricate designs that require specialised craftsmanship. Custom options corresponding to vaulted ceilings, elaborate staircases, or in depth landscaping can contribute to escalating construction budgets.
Another essential factor is the timing of construction. Labor and materials could additionally be cheaper during certain times of the 12 months. Builders typically strategize their projects to align with developments in the market, aiming to minimize costs. For occasion, starting construction in late fall or winter could present lower costs, nevertheless it also introduces challenges such as inclement climate.
Financing choices and rates of interest further have an effect on residential construction prices. With fluctuating mortgage charges, homeowners must remain vigilant. Higher rates of interest can dissuade potential patrons from buying newly constructed properties, which may lead builders to minimize back costs or offer incentives, finally affecting general construction prices.

Sustainable building practices have gained traction lately, influencing residential construction prices in each constructive and adverse methods. While preliminary expenses for environmentally-friendly materials and applied sciences may be higher, the long-term savings on energy payments can offset these costs. Homebuyers are increasingly thinking about sustainability, making green contains a worthwhile investment for builders.
In evaluating residential construction costs, potential consumers should additionally think about long-term upkeep and operational bills. Energy-efficient homes may have higher upfront costs but end in decrease utility bills over time. Homeowners should assess whole lifetime prices somewhat than focusing solely on instant bills.
